What I love most about knitting - besides being able to create practical garments by hand - is that with every single project, my skills increase and I learn something new.  Learning how to knit initially is certainly a milestone, but the learning doesn't just stop after you master how to cast on, knit and purl.  The more you knit, the more you learn; and the more you learn, the more projects you'll want to make.  With this ongoing process of absorbing knitting tips and techniques daily, it's no wonder why so many knitters have dozens of new projects lined up and even more started or nearly completed. Knitting is fun and addictive, and who doesn't like learning a few knitting tips and techniques to keep the fun going on and on? 


Even if you've been knitting for years, a good tip never hurt anyone!  In this special collection, AllFreeKnitting has rounded up some of the best videos YouTube has to offer.  From learning how to pick up dropped stitches, to making sure you wash your hand knit garments properly, this collection will give you quick tips and knitting tricks that you can use for years.

Mattress Stitch Seaming 

By Knitting Help

Once you finish a knit project, seaming is another monster entirely.  Thanks to this video, it doesn't have to be a scary monster.  Learn how to conquer the popular mattress stitch seaming method.  With this easy seaming technique, your work will be left without a visible seam.

Picking up Dropped Stitches 

By Make Magazine 

We've all been there before, we let a few stitches drop from our needles and we didn't know what to do.  Don't frog your work, because there's no need.  Watch this video and learn how a simple latch hook tool can save you hours of extra work.

 

How to Knit Backwards 

By MonicaKnits

If you make a mistake while knitting, simply knit in reverse and go back to the point before the mistake was made.  It's not as scary as it sounds; watch this video to see how it's done.
